About the Role

This position is part of the Corporate Services department within the IS-Epic team, located at 3535 Market Street in Philadelphia. The role operates on a hybrid schedule, Monday through Friday during daylight hours.

The Application Teams are responsible for the effective implementation, optimization, maintenance, and support of Epic System applications at Penn Medicine. Analysts in this role contribute to the seamless delivery of Epic solutions, ensuring high-quality patient care and operational excellence. You will serve as a liaison between operational departments and Information Services, utilizing your expertise to design, build, and test application software that supports and optimizes operational processes.

This position is posted at three levels based on experience: Associate, Mid-level, and Senior. Candidates will be aligned to the appropriate level based on their qualifications. The role reports to the EpicCare Ambulatory team and requires candidates to live within Maryland, Delaware, Pennsylvania, or New Jersey, or be willing to relocate.

Key Responsibilities

  • check_circlePerform analysis, troubleshooting, and problem solving of technical and application issues
  • check_circleCollaborate with Epic support teams and vendors to address complex technical issues
  • check_circleDesign, build, install, modify, and test application software to optimize processes
  • check_circleDefine and document user requirements and system scope for enhancements
  • check_circleCommunicate workflow changes and best practice solutions to operational stakeholders
  • check_circleMaintain thorough documentation of configurations, customizations, and support processes
  • check_circleAct as a liaison between operational departments and Information Services
  • check_circleAssure full integration of systems and devices using interfacing standards
  • check_circleProvide guidance to team members and contribute to decision-making processes
  • check_circleIdentify root causes and implement changes to resolve system problems

Requirements

  • verifiedH.S. Diploma/GED and 4+ years IT experience (Associate level)
  • verifiedAssociate's Degree and 3+ years IT experience (Associate level)
  • verifiedBachelor's Degree in IT or related field (Associate level)
  • verifiedH.S. Diploma/GED and 6+ years Healthcare Applications/EMR experience (Analyst level)
  • verifiedAssociate's Degree and 5+ years Healthcare Applications/EMR experience (Analyst level)
  • verifiedBachelor's Degree and 3+ years Healthcare Applications/EMR experience (Analyst level)
  • verifiedH.S. Diploma/GED and 8+ years Healthcare Applications/EMR experience (Senior level)
  • verifiedAssociate's Degree and 7+ years Healthcare Applications/EMR experience (Senior level)
  • verifiedBachelor's Degree and 5+ years Healthcare Applications/EMR experience (Senior level)
  • verifiedEpic Certification preferred (Associate level)
  • verifiedEpic Certification required (Analyst and Senior levels)
  • verifiedMust live in Maryland, Delaware, Pennsylvania, New Jersey, or be willing to relocate
